The Health Administration Case Competition provides graduate students from CAHME-accredited health administration programs an opportunity to put what they have learned into practice with a real-life, real-time case. It is designed to be a capstone experience for the graduate school experience.
Student teams from around the country travel to Birmingham, Alabama to present their recommendations before a national team of judges. The first, second and third place teams receive cash awards.
The 5th Annual Health Administration Case Competition was held February 15-17, 2012. All participating teams are considered winners by participating in this integrative case competition; however, a few additional winners include:
1st Place: Baruch/Mt. Sinai College
2nd Place: University of Central Florida
3rd Place: University of North Carolina - Chapel Hill
Finalists: Penn State, Johns Hopkins University and George Washington University.
